Transaction 3ba0c23811362bbcac38e9d4f83f538f61be4f97d6a6aeb77d85bf81ca6cb9b2
1 Input
1 Output
-
3ba0c23811362bbcac38e9d4f83f538f61be4f97d6a6aeb77d85bf81ca6cb9b2:0
- value
- 779067
- script pubkey
- OP_0 OP_PUSHBYTES_20 755529b2c2e393c3ee56bee20c6213f765fece66
- address
- bc1qw42jnvkzuwfu8mjkhm3qccsn7ajlannxne8lxd